Job Summary:

Reporting to Administrator of Physical Medicine & Rehabilitation, Neurological Institute and Transplant Center, the administrative assistant will provide administrative/secretarial support to the Physical Medicine & Rehabilitation Administration Department, Neurological Institute for Operations, Inpatient Rehab & Medical Director and Transplant center support. Coordinating all aspects of PM&R administration operations, including planning, organizing, utilizing, controlling resources. Responsible for coordinating various administrative duties to include coordinating office management, calendars, meetings minutes, special projects as assigned, maintenance and control of supply purchase, coordinates updates to policies and procedures, participating in committees. Facilitate open lines of communication with staff, business managers, directors, PM&R leadership team, physicians, residents, patients and family.

Minimum Qualifications:

Bachelors Degree and one (1) year relevant administrative experience OR Associates Degree and three (3) years relevant administrative experience OR equivalent combination of education and experience required. Excellent written/oral communication, organizational and computer skills necessary. Ability to work effectively with all levels of administration and medical staff personnel; demonstrated creativity, and mature judgment necessary in anticipating and solving problems.

Preferred Qualifications:

PM&R, Neurosciences and/or Health care experience preferred.
